How To Choose The Best Product To Make Grey Hair Shine
Grey hair lacks melanin, which means it also lacks the natural pigment that protects strands from UV damage and environmental yellowing. The right product must address three things: tone correction, hydration, and light reflection.
Pigment Type and Color Correction
Violet pigments neutralize yellow undertones. Products with higher pigment concentration work faster but require careful application to avoid a purple tint on lighter greys. If your hair is mostly white, a gentle conditioner with light pigment is safer than a heavy mask.
Moisture vs. Protein Balance
Grey cuticles are often raised and porous, which leads to frizz and dryness without enough moisture. A product rich in argan oil, silk proteins, or pro-vitamin B5 will smooth the cuticle and boost shine without weighing hair down. Too much protein can make grey hair brittle, so formulas that prioritize hydration are the safer choice for consistent use.
